c2c's Essex Ultra Marathon to return this September
Local rail operator c2c Railway has announced that its successful Essex Ultra Marathon event is returning for a third consecutive year this September.
Following the success of the 2024 and 2025 events, c2c has announced that its popular Essex Ultra Marathon will be returning for a third consecutive year on Saturday 12 September.
This year’s event, which is open to people of all ages (18 and over) and abilities, includes 10, 30 and 50-mile race options, with all distances taking in the Essex Riviera while closely following the c2c train route from Upminster, Tilbury and Leigh-on-sea down to Southend-on-Sea.
All proceeds from this year’s event - raised through race entry fees and additional sponsorship - will again be donated to charity, with the official partner set to be announced soon.
c2c Managing Director, Rob Mullen, said:“As a keen runner and fitness enthusiast, I am delighted that c2c is again hosting its popular Essex Ultra Marathon this September alongside our friends at XNRG.
“This year’s Ultra sees the addition of a new 10-mile route, which I hope will inspire even more people - including many members of the c2c team and the communities we serve – to lace up their trainers and walk, jog or run the Essex Thameside."
The 10, 30 and 50-mile routes will start at Benfleet station, Tilbury (Lansdowne Primary Academy) and Upminister station respectively, before heading out east along the Essex Riviera to the finish line at Thorpedene Primary School in Shoeburyness.
All those registered to take part in the c2c Essex Ultra Marathon will receive free travel on the c2c route to and from the race.
Registrations for all distances will open shortly, so keep your eye on xnrg.co.uk/events/c2c-essex-ultra or sign-up to the mailing list for further information.
The entry fees for all three races are as follows:
10-miles
Standard - £39
30-miles
Early bird - £75 (register before 12 August)
Standard - £85
50-Mile Route
Early bird - £95 (register before 12 August)
Standard - £105
